Physical development and risky play

This week in the baby room we promoted the development of motor skills with lots of activities to aid physical development. We practiced our standing and balancing whilst we built tall towers with the soft play. And then we practiced our had eye coordination whilst climbing the climbing frame.  This activity promoted independence amongst the babies and for them to take and asses risks with an adult close by to aid and assist them. The babies also loved playing peek-a-boo with their friends and adults at each end of the tunnel.  The babies then had the opportunity to take their physical development activities outdoors whilst they v=carefully crawled across the balancing beams in the garden.
